[Bug 217732] Re: package base-files 4.0.1ubuntu4 failed to install/upgrade: unable to stat `./mnt' (which I was about to install)

2009-04-16 Thread Ferrix Hovi
Solved it actually. When something is mounted on /mnt unpacking fails. I
am not sure if the mount needs to be irresponsive at the time (I had a
disconnected samba mount).

This error isn't obvious and clearly it shouldn't matter if something is
mounted on an existing directory while we are trying to create the
directory itself. I suggest this be fixed since it seems like a rather
simple thing in how the directories are handled and may result in moon-
phase bugs such as this.
